MLB Bullets Still Has No Games To Talk About

The trade market is quiet, at least so far. Alex Rodriguez is coming back. The Nationals and Indians need to make some changes going forward. A Cuban pitcher loves Des Moines and isn't going back. Bud Selig wants a new ballpark in Tampa Bay and Rob Neyer isn't happy with a new one in Flushing.
